Vehicle Description
Sales numbers really jumped up in '69, with the Camaro pushing
243,085 units off the lots. Part of the success was due to the
refreshed styling, which saw skinnier three-block taillights, two
large round headlights pushed all the way to the sides of the
grille, a pointier front fascia, and slightly reworked body panels.
If the buyer chose the RS trim, the headlights were made flush with
the grille, and three stacked slits covered the lights. This was
also the first year that variable-ratio power steering became an
option. SS trims offered a 300hp 350 V8 or a 375hp 396. Largely
considered one of the most beautiful cars of all time, the '69
would later provide direct inspiration for the fifth-gen
Camaros.
A fine example of the 1st generation Camaro. This 1969 Camaro is an
original X11 350 SS car. This offering is a high-end, older quality
restoration that shows a few small stone chips here and there from
enjoying the car. Absolutely a stunning car with the burgundy color
and orange stripes to the beautiful white interior. All body panels
appear to be original and the underside of the car is as nice as
the top. The drive train consists of a 396ci 375hp big block,
Muncie 4-speed manual transmission and a 12 bolt rear-end. Hurst
shifter with line lock. Interior has full SS gauge package with
console and a Hurst shifter with line lock.
